WebDescription: A Simple Harmonic Motion, or SHM, is defined as a motion in which the restoring force is directly proportional to the displacement of the body from its mean position. The direction of this restoring force is always towards the mean position. The acceleration of a particle executing simple harmonic motion is given by a (t) = -ω2 x (t). Webharmonic motion n. A periodic vibration, as of a pendulum, in which the motions are symmetrical about a region of equilibrium. In Newtonian mechanics, for one-dimensional simple harmonic motion, the equation of motion, which is a second-order linear ordinary differential equation with constant coefficients, can be obtained by means of Newton's 2nd law and Hooke's law for a mass on a spring.
